India, Nov. 24 -- D2C beauty and skincare brand FAE Beauty has raised INR 17 Cr (about $2 Mn) in a funding round led by Spring Marketing Capital. The round also saw participation from Titan Capital, Winners Fund, Arihant Patni, and select angel investors.

In a statement, the startup said it will use the funds for product innovation, enter new categories, and strengthen its omnichannel presence by expanding across online marketplaces, quick commerce, and offline retail.

Founded in 2019 by Karishma Kewalramani, FAE Beauty offers beauty and skincare products, focussing on inclusivity and shade diversity for Indian skin tones. The startup claims that its eyes and lips products carry formulations for hydration and anti-pigmentation.
